Sholakoceras pleuronautiloides
Taxonomy
Trematodiscus pleuronautiloides was named by Gemmellaro (1889). It is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Pietra di Salomone, calcare grossolano, Sosio, which is in a Wordian carbonate limestone in Italy.
It was recombined as Sholakoceras pleuronautiloides by Mapes et al. (2007).
